/**
 * Wrapper around the JSON object passed through JS which contains all
 * possible option values. Class provides simple readers and more advanced
 * methods to convert independent values into platform specific values.
 */
public class Options {

    // Key name for bundled extras
    static final String EXTRA = "NOTIFICATION_OPTIONS";

    // The original JSON object
    private JSONObject options = new JSONObject();

    // Repeat interval
    private long interval = 0;

    // Application context
    private final Context context;

    // Asset util instance
    private final AssetUtil assets;


    /**
     * Constructor
     *
     * @param context
     *      Application context
     */
    public Options(Context context){
    	this.context = context;
        this.assets  = AssetUtil.getInstance(context);
    }

    /**
     * Parse given JSON properties.
     *
     * @param options
     *      JSON properties
     */
    public Options parse (JSONObject options) {
        this.options = options;

        parseInterval();
        parseAssets();

        return this;
    }

    /**
     * Parse repeat interval.
     */
    private void parseInterval() {
        String every = options.optString("every").toLowerCase();

        if (every.isEmpty()) {
            interval = 0;
        } else
        if (every.equals("second")) {
            interval = 1000;
        } else
        if (every.equals("minute")) {
            interval = AlarmManager.INTERVAL_FIFTEEN_MINUTES / 15;
        } else
        if (every.equals("hour")) {
            interval = AlarmManager.INTERVAL_HOUR;
        } else
        if (every.equals("day")) {
            interval = AlarmManager.INTERVAL_DAY;
        } else
        if (every.equals("week")) {
            interval = AlarmManager.INTERVAL_DAY * 7;
        } else
        if (every.equals("month")) {
            interval = AlarmManager.INTERVAL_DAY * 31;
        } else
        if (every.equals("quarter")) {
            interval = AlarmManager.INTERVAL_HOUR * 2190;
        } else
        if (every.equals("year")) {
            interval = AlarmManager.INTERVAL_DAY * 365;
        } else {
            try {
                interval = Integer.parseInt(every) * 60000;
            } catch (Exception e) {
                e.printStackTrace();
            }
        }
    }
